Gujarat Cracks Down on Illegal Bangladeshi Immigrants; Over 1,000 Detained in Ahmedabad and Surat

Ahmedabad, Gujarat – In what is being described as the state’s biggest-ever crackdown on illegal immigration, the Gujarat government has detained over 1,000 suspected Bangladeshi nationals in Ahmedabad and Surat in a single night, officials confirmed. The large-scale operation, conducted jointly by police and intelligence units, led to the detention of 890 individuals in Ahmedabad and 134 in Surat. These detentions are part of an ongoing state-wide effort that has seen nearly 6,500 undocumented individuals taken into custody so far.

According to Gujarat DGP Vikas Sahay, the detainees are currently being questioned, and both documentary and technological evidence are being gathered to verify their nationality. Only after confirmation of their Bangladeshi identity will deportation procedures begin. “This is part of a larger campaign to identify and remove foreign nationals illegally residing in the state,” Sahay stated.

The massive operation highlights increasing concerns over illegal immigration and its potential impact on local resources and security. The state government has reiterated its commitment to maintaining law and order while following due legal processes. Further investigations are underway, and authorities have not ruled out more detentions in the coming days as the verification process continues.
